About The Company
LindenGrove Communities, conveniently located throughout Waukesha County, Wisconsin, is a not-for-profit organization of care facilities that has been faithfully serving seniors of Southeastern Wisconsin since 1987. Our wide range of services is continuously expanding to meet the needs of older adults. We offer non-medical in home services, assisted living apartments, memory care homes, rehabilitation services, respite care, bridge rooms and skilled nursing centers.

As the DON, some responsibilities include but are not limited to:

  • Develop, organize and maintain a standard of nursing practice that is compliant with the company objectives as well as state and federal regulatory agencies.
  • Supervise functions, activities and training of nursing personnel.
  • Assure quality of care adhering to best practices around inflectional prevention and control provided by the nursing department.
  • Develop and maintain standards of nursing practice and policies and procedures and provides oversight of practice.
  • Ensure that duties of nursing personnel are clearly defined and assigned to staff consistent with their level of educational preparation, experience and licensure.
  • Maintain and actively promotes effective communication with all individuals.

Requirements

  • Registered Nurse (RN) license in the State of Wisconsin.
  • Knowledge and/or experience in geriatrics.
  • Management experience.
  • Knowledge and/or experience with state and federal regulations.
